Transaction 679fd92e492b64b2eb5a60af428603739d23d9942b8f38d237ac1795a522c618

2 Input
2 Outputs
  • 679fd92e492b64b2eb5a60af428603739d23d9942b8f38d237ac1795a522c618:0
  • value  338586
    address  3K8bxWcfubkDCCJqaxgp4d4enZAMwV4gwH
  • 679fd92e492b64b2eb5a60af428603739d23d9942b8f38d237ac1795a522c618:1
  • value  2002741
    address  32LpRTbah8e9rWmVRecJmuy9qYhKefcmNk